Horn, Roland S. A retired Advocate employee, he died at 6 a.m. on Thursday, July 21, 2005, at his home in Baton Rouge. He was 69, born in Dequincy on Oct. 13, 1935, and a U.S. Air Force veteran. Visiting at Rabenhorst Funeral Home East, 11000 Florida Blvd. on Sunday, July 24, from 4 p.m. to 8 p.m. Visiting at the funeral home chapel on Monday, July 25, from 8 a.m. until religious service at 10 a.m., conducted by the Rev. Jack Smith. Interment in Port Hudson National Cemetery. Roland was born and raised on the west side of the great state of Louisiana. He enjoyed a childhood around DeQuincy and did stints in the military which took him to the Far East, making an everlasting impression on him. He mostly hung around newspapers. He reported, edited, swept floors, sold ads, published, helped crank-up a couple of publications and worked with some fine folks at the Lake Charles American Press and The Advocate newspaper. Roland is survived by a wife who loved him a lot, Beverly Ann Ancona Horn; two daughters, Amy Gail Horn of Baton Rouge and Deborah LaRosa of Tallahassee, Fla.; two sons, Roland Jr. of Baton Rouge and John Westly Horn of Carlyss; stepsons, Michael Fontenot and Dr. David Sledge and his wife, Gina, of Baton Rouge, John Sledge of Baton Rouge and Charles "Chuck" Sledge and his wife, Liz, of Houston; granddaughters, Sarah Jane Sledge, Sage Carter Horn and Amber Gail Horn and Averie Marie Sledge and Grace Sledge; grandsons, Ethan David Sledge, Jacob Ray Sledge and James Sledge; brother, Readis Horn and his dear wife, Patsy, of Mena, Ark.; a number of nieces and nephews that were all his favorites; an uncle and two aunts; sisters-in-law, Norma, Catherine, Patsy, Tish and Joyce; and brothers-in-law, A.J. Lasseigne, Ronnie Gerald and Charles Ancona. Roland was preceded in death by his wife, Wanda Gail Foster Horn; son; sister, Olive Ann Horn Walker; and brother-in-law, Billy Murray "Doak" Walker. Funeral service at Rabenhorst East Funeral Home on Florida Boulevard, with everyone invited, especially the many people who called him friend. Burial will be in the national cemetery on the way to St. Francisville. Roland wrote this obit and would have liked for it not to be changed hardly at all. If your name was left out, you have to remember he had brain surgery. "It's been a real show."
